There are many benefits to looking for private mental health services over public alternatives. Some key benefits include:
1. Accessibility and Reduced Wait Times
Public mental health services can typically have long haul times, which may worsen the mental health concern. Private services generally offer greater accessibility, permitting people to book visits more rapidly.
2. Personalized Care
Private practices tend to have smaller caseloads, which can lead to more personalized care. Clients can anticipate customized treatment strategies that address their unique requirements and preferences.
3. Specialized Expertise
Private mental health services frequently supply specialized care. Patients can choose experts with knowledge in specific areas such as trauma, dependency, or child and teen mental health.
4. Confidentiality
Personal privacy is frequently increased in the private sector, as these services are less accessible to external scrutiny compared to public alternatives. This confidentiality can promote a safer space for people to share and heal.
5. Flexible Scheduling
Many private providers use versatile hours, consisting of evening and weekend visits, catering to patients with hectic schedules.
6. Differed Treatment Options
Private services may offer a larger range of treatment choices, including alternative therapies (such as art therapy or equine treatment) that may not be readily available in public settings.
Challenges of Private Mental Health Services
While private psychiatrists uk mental health services provide various advantages, they also present challenges that prospective clients should think about:
1. Cost of Services
Private mental health services can be expensive, and not everybody has insurance protection that sufficiently assists in access. This may develop barriers for people who can not manage the out-of-pocket expenses.
2. Limited Insurance Coverage
Insurance coverage plans may have limitations on which mental health suppliers are covered, and some services may just be left out. This limits access for those who want to receive private care.
3. Irregularity in Quality
Simply as with any private service industry, the quality of mental health care can vary substantially between providers and centers. Clients are encouraged to carry out thorough research to find credible professionals.
4. Lack of Continuity of Care
Clients changing in between private suppliers or in between public and private services may in some cases deal with difficulties related to the continuity of care, which can prevent development in treatment.
